If you think you’re the only sound engineer who doesn’t know everything
’technical’, you’re wrong! This course is designed to extend your practical and theoretical experience in the technical aspects of sound and sound production, complementing your operational knowledge. It won’t qualify you as a technician, but it will make you more confident when difficulties arise with state-of-the–art technology. No longer will you fear the ghost in the machine!

Course Director Chris McKeith is the AFTRS Sound Department Mix lecturer, and a Digidesign Certified Trainer. Chris has extensive experience with digital audio workstations and mixing systems, and prior to joining AFTRS Chris worked in commercial TV, as well as and operating his own music and post-production studio.
